Aldi and Williams Bros call on Scots beer lovers to help name new beer

Scottish beer lovers to help them name the latest addition to their beer lineup with the successful entrant also winning the very first case of the brand-new brew. Teaming up with long-term supplier, the Alloa based Williams Bros, the firms have brewed a tropical New England White IPA which will be sold in stores across the UK.

Relief for Scotland as Kieran Tierney's injury diagnosis should have ex-Celtic star back for Euros

Kieran Tierney will miss the next four to six weeks with a knee injury, his club Arsenal have confirmed. The left-back was forced off in the recent loss to Liverpool with manager Mikel Arteta calling it a potentially “serious” issue.

35 years on - a look back at Highlander, the film that gave Scotland tourism appeal before Outlander

Outlander effect in full swing before the pandemic hit, tourism to Scotland was soaring due to the popularity of the hit TV show. Filming locations such as Doune Castle and Blackness Castle saw visitor numbers rise by over 300%, as Outlander fans sought out the stunning backdrops shown on the show.

Love Island's Laura Anderson 'moving back to Dubai after struggling with lockdown in Scotland'

Laura Anderson is reportedly planning to move back to Dubai "permanently" after struggling with lockdown in Scotland. The Scottish reality star, who recently moved to Stirling to stay with her dad, used to live in the UAE city while working as an air hostess before she appeared on the ITV dating show.

Aldi’s sell-out £350 Spa Pool is coming back this weekend - how to get one

Aldi is bringing back a £350 Spa Pool that is expected to sell out soon after it goes on sale this weekend. Sales of inflatable hot tubs went through the roof last year as Scots snapped up the luxurious garden accessory during the initial lockdown period and readied themselves for a summer at home.
